AIS Indonesia - Bali



  • Independent parent commentary on the Bali campus is very thin. The single platform review on file is from a teacher describing weak teaching effort, photocopied black-and-white reading materials, and detached leadership. The same review marks academics, facilities and administration as good.
  • The school is the Bali sister of AIS Indonesia (Jakarta and Bali campuses), running an Australian curriculum to Year 10 and the IB Diploma in Years 11 and 12.
  • Sport facilities, including the competition-standard pool, are mentioned as a strength across general directory write-ups.
  • The school's stated stance on inclusive education is its main marketing claim. Independent parent verification of that in practice did not surface in the sources searched.
